#23ca5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23ca5d is composed of 13.7% red, 79.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 54%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 140.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#23ca5d color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ffba with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#23ca5d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#23ca5d has RGB values of R:35, G:202,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2345565.

Shades and Tints of #23ca5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23ca5d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757876 is the less saturated color, while #08e555 is the most saturated one.
